Job Description

The Quality Management System (QMS) department develops, supports, and oversees the company's global quality processes to strengthen product integrity and enhance the customer experience. The QMS applies across all value streams within the organization.


To further improve quality performance, the QMS North America team is expanding to establish a dedicated group focused on ensuring that quality processes are clearly defined, effectively deployed, consistently followed, and reliably executed. This added focus will reduce quality issues and customer risk while improving key performance indicators (KPIs).



The Quality Audit / QMS Manager is responsible for developing and ensuring the effective execution of quality audit programs across multiple business areas, including design, engineering, purchasing, manufacturing, supplier quality, supply chain, sales/aftersales, and other crossfunctional domains.



This role conducts quality risk assessments and establishes audit programs that assess potential customer risks while ensuring alignment with sponsors and leadership. The Manager oversees audit execution to ensure activities are completed in a timely, respectful, transparent, and valueadded manner. Responsibilities include communicating with managers and leadership, addressing escalations, validating audit findings, confirming action plans, and driving closure and crossfunctional readacross of results.



Additionally, the Manager serves as a key liaison, collaborating with regional and global quality audit teams to ensure alignment and consistency across the organization.



They will also perform complex audits across multiple domains, which include:



  • Planning and preparing the audit
  • Conducting audit activities
  • Analyzing and interpreting findings
  • Supporting the development and approving corrective action plans
  • Ensuring actions are implemented, completed, and effective
  • Documenting comprehensive audit reports and results


In addition, the Quality Audit / QMS Manager will be responsible for overseeing critical Quality Management System (QMS) activities within the North America region, including:



  • Leading the development, validation, and approval of global and regional quality standards, representing North American stakeholders across all company domains.
  • Overseeing the deployment of QMS quality standards within the region by collaborating closely with global process owners, the global QMS organization, and QMS Domain Leads to ensure consistent and effective implementation.
  • Driving improvements to global and regional quality processes based on audit outcomes and identified needs from North American stakeholders.


The Quality Audit / QMS Manager will build strong relationships with key quality stakeholders across North America and global QMS teams, ensuring clear and consistent communication on audit status, findings, corrective actions, escalations, and ongoing process improvements.


The Manager must excel in navigating ambiguity, making sound, datadriven decisions, and effectively managing escalated issues. Strong collaboration skills are essential, as the role interacts with all levels of management to gather information through formal reports, informal discussions and escalation activities.



The Manager will also support regional and global audit activities, including risk assessments, audit planning, and recruitment efforts. Travel of up to approximately 25% may be required to conduct or support audits across the company's full value stream, including engineering sites, Stellantis facilities, dealer networks, and supplier locations.
